Would a 'variable' state pension age be fairer?

Wednesday, January 12, 2011 - 15:50 in Mathematics & Economics

(PhysOrg.com) -- A study suggests the government should introduce a variable state pension age to acknowledge the wide variations in life expectancy across the UK. It also warns the current state pension system is unsustainable even after the state pension age is raised in line with government plans.
